Question:
I would like to let you know that there is a glitch in your search function for RAM Promaster hitches. The Curt 13207 doesn’t come up in a search for the Promaster. However when you search for the hitch first, your system confirms it’s compatibility. This has been for a while now and has been discussed on the Promaster Forum. Just thought I let you know because you’re potentially loosing out on sales.
asked by: Martina R
Expert Reply:
Hey Martina, so the Curt Class III hitch part # C13207 is still in our fitguide results for the 2017 Ram Promaster so I am not sure there's much we can change (see attached link) but I apologize for any difficulty finding it on our site.
